It is used in a driver [1] in an OF specific function. The patch is in my second series that depends this one. "[PATCH RFC 00/12] Device tree support for Exynos4 SoC camera drivers" I thought it was better to add this empty macro definition rather than using #ifdef CONFIG_OF in the code. However, in this case the local variables would remain unused, so it's not really any good solution. It just looked cumbersome to me to have in the code something like #ifdef CONFIG_OF int func(void) { int x; .... return x; } #else #define func() (-ENOSYS) #endif After all it's not that bad and allows to compile out all OF code when it's unused.
